Design Architect Salary
The average design architect salary is $75,554 per year in the United States in 2026. Base pay runs from $54,000 at the 10th percentile to $120,000 at the 90th, with a median of $76,000. Bonuses add $860–$18,000, putting total pay between roughly $52,000 and $129,000.

What is the average design architect salary?
The average base salary for a Design Architect is $75,554 per year. This figure represents the typical earnings for professionals in this role as of 2026.
The 10th percentile earns $54,000, while the 90th percentile reaches $120,000, indicating a significant spread in earnings. This range suggests that experience, location, and project complexity can greatly influence salary outcomes.
Known limitations. The data is based on a sample size of 1,334 profiles, and variations may occur due to geographic and industry differences.

How is design architect total pay structured?
Design Architect compensation may include base salary and bonuses.
| Component | Low | High | Reading |
|---|---|---|---|
| Base salary | $54,000 | $120,000 | Dense around the $76k median |
| Annual bonus | $860 | $18,000 | Up to ~15% of top-end base |
| Total pay | $52,000 | $129,000 | Base plus reported bonus |
